Manila, Philippines, February 16, 2026FedEx successfully delivered over 20,000 pounds of hot air balloons and drones from Asia, Canada, Europe, Latin America, and the United States for the 26th Philippine International Hot Air Balloon Fiesta (PIHABF). Themed “A Weekend of Everything that Flies,” the event took place from February 13 to 15, 2026, at New Clark City.
